Athletic Greens is a popular daily greens supplement that does not contain caffeine, making it an ideal choice for those seeking to enhance their nutritional intake without the stimulating effects of caffeine.Jul 24, 2023 · Does AG1 break a fast? Yes, drinking AG1 would break a fast. In order to fast you can’t consume anything with any calories, meaning things like water and black coffee are fine, but AG1 with its 50 calories per scoop would be technically breaking your fast. No, Bulletproof coffee doesn’t break your fast. In fact, it may promote ketosis and speed up fat burning! Bulletproof coffee—also known as keto coffee—is a mixture of black coffee, medium-chain triglycerides, and unsalted butter. Technically, taking anything that isn’t pure water or tea/coffee without milk does count as breaking your fast. This is because even though most super greens powders are low in carbs, sugars, and overall energy density, they are not calorie-free. So, taking Athletic Greens, or regular super greens will break your fast.Is your body absorbing the optimal amount of nutrients from the food you eat? So yes, consuming honey does break ... Jul 15, 2022 · The unflavored LMNT only contains the minerals themselves. It doesn't contain any flavoring, so it doesn't have any grams of carbs, protein or fat. Because of this, regardless of what type of Intermittent Fasting you're using, the raw unflavored LMNT will not break a fast.
